(By Erik Shirokoff; copied from the Joe Frank Reminder)

Joe Frank has requested that his fans not publish transcripts of his work, and I fully respect that wish. I believe that these descriptions are so incomplete and useless to anyone who hasn't already heard the programs that making them available online shouldn't be a problem. If anyone disagrees (particularly anyone representing Joe or his producers), please let me know.

Copyright of this document is complicated. I would generally classify it as fair use, similar to the countless movie and television program databases which are published online. I should therefore own the copyright. At the same time, if someone were to produce a script for a radio program based entirely on a description here, I suspect that Joe Frank would be able to successfully claim infringement. To whatever degree I own the work, therefore, it seems that I am not entirely free to publish it under a Creative Commons or GFDL license.

Until someone comes up with a better idea, I claim the copyright on everything contained in this document. You may not do anything with this text, aside from personal use, without first obtaining my explicit permission. If it sounds like something to which Joe might object, I'll tell you to ask his agents as well.


(Since writing this, Erik explicitly granted the Joe Frank community permission to re-use content on his site to populate the Joe Frank Wiki.)
